[Releasing] Meeting minutes from Qt Release Team meeting 12.11.2019

Jani Heikkinen jani.heikkinen at qt.io
Wed Nov 13 09:42:54 CET 2019


Meeting minutes from Qt Release Team meeting Tue 12th November 2019

Qt 5.14.0:
- Beta3 released today
   * Most of bigger issues should be now fixed in beta3
--> Let's start branching from '5.14' to '5.14.0'  Wed 13th November & finalize it Wed 20th November
- Few issues open in release blocker list https://bugreports.qt.io/issues/?filter=21539
   * Let's see if we can fix all open ones soon enough to have RC as next release or do we still need beta4
- Initial changes files will be created immediately after branching starts
   * Please finalize those immediately after initial ones available

Qt 5.12.6:
- We should have release content in place & testing is ongoing
- We will release these packages as Qt 5.12.6 later this week if nothing serious found during testing

Closing '5.13':
- '5.13' will be closed after '5.14.0' is available
- '5.13' will be merged to '5.14' before final downmerge from '5.14' to '5.14.0'

Next meeting Tue 26th November 2019 16:00 CET

br,
Jani Heikkinen
Release Manager

irc log below:
[17:00:24] <jaheikki3> akseli: iieklund: thiago: lars: frkleint: vladimir-m: ankokko: mapaaso:carewolf: fregl: ablasche: ping
[17:01:11] <vladimir-m> jaheikki3: pong
[17:02:06] <frkleint> jaheikki3: ping
[17:02:10] <jaheikki3> Time to start qt release team meeting
[17:02:17] <jaheikki3> On agenda today:
[17:02:21] <thiago> jaheikki3: pong
[17:02:26] <jaheikki3> Qt 5.14.0 status
[17:02:31] <jaheikki3> Qt 5.12.6 status
[17:02:44] <jaheikki3> Any additional items to the agenda?
[17:04:23] <jaheikki3> Let's start from Qt 5.14.0 status
[17:04:35] <jaheikki3> Beta3 released today
[17:05:01] <jaheikki3> Most of bigger issues should be now fixed in beta3 
[17:05:06] <frkleint> WebEnigne?
[17:05:16] <jaheikki3> frkleint: should be
[17:05:52] <jaheikki3> frkleint: But ok, there is new compilation issues in WE preventing new qt5.git integration
[17:06:04] <jaheikki3> Hoping those will be fixed soon
[17:06:38] <jaheikki3> I think we should start branching from '5.14' to '5.14.0' now to be ready for RC
[17:07:06] <jaheikki3> There is still few issues open in release blocker list, see https://bugreports.qt.io/issues/?filter=21539
[17:07:24] <jaheikki3> so let's see if we can fix all open ones soon enough to have RC as next release or do we still need beta4
[17:07:38] <jaheikki3> But both can be done from .0 branch
[17:07:49] <jaheikki3> Initial changes files will be created immediately after branching starts
[17:07:59] <jaheikki3> Please finalize those immediately after initial ones available
[17:08:14] <jaheikki3> That's pretty much all about 5.14.0 status. Any comments or questions?
[17:08:42] <thiago> checking the eblocking issues
[17:09:31] <thiago> ok, nothing I can help with...
[17:09:45] <thiago> we had decided that we close the 5.13 branch when we open 5.14.0, right?
[17:10:00] <jaheikki3> thiago: yes, that's true
[17:11:04] <thiago> ok, so we also need to announce that and close it
[17:11:33] <thiago> what is easiest, last merge of 5.13 into 5.14 then branch, or branch and then merge 5.13 into 5.14.0?
[17:12:31] <thiago> I'm reading only 7 commits in qtbase that need to be merged
[17:12:54] <jaheikki3> thiago: Yes, recent merge is done only a while ago
[17:13:40] <jaheikki3> thiago: I don't see that big difference about those options. Maybe we just start branching, close 5.13 and do the merge before final downmerge?
[17:14:14] <thiago> fair enough
[17:15:06] <jaheikki3> Great, let's proceed with that plan
[17:15:11] <jaheikki3> Then Qt 5.12.6 status
[17:15:21] <jaheikki3> We have release content in place
[17:15:32] <jaheikki3> Packages are created & testing is ongoing
[17:16:01] <jaheikki3> If nothing really serious found we will release these packages as Qt 5.12.6 later this week
[17:16:25] <jaheikki3> That's all about 5.12.6. Any comments or questions?
[17:17:30] <thiago> nothing from me
[17:18:16] <jaheikki3> Ok, this was all at this time. Let's end the meeting now & have new one Tue 19th November at this same time
[17:18:29] <frkleint> jaheikki3: Are you attending QtCS? .... My revolutionary proposal would be to not create changelogs when nothing has changed in a module..
[17:18:45] <frkleint> would save adding tons of empty files...
[17:19:13] <jaheikki3> frkleint: yes I am. So let's skip next weeks meeting & have new one tue 26th November
[17:19:34] <frkleint> ok
[17:19:49] <jaheikki3> frkleint: that's OK for me. It is a bit silly to create those empty ones...
[17:20:16] <thiago> well, next week's meeting would be in the middle of QtCS
[17:20:19] <frkleint> ok ,sounds good ;-)
[17:20:27] <thiago> we should have sessions about releasing, though, just not this meeting
[17:20:53] <jaheikki3> thiago: yeah, we can have that. I'll book a slot
[17:22:59] <jaheikki3> But let's end this meeting now. Thanks for your participation & see you next week in QtCS!
[17:23:59] <frkleint> ok, bye






More information about the Releasing mailing list